Output cd3c24ed3b66516813c67e83d620e6eedfced6c641a5f442882378c59da8bbe7:7

value
51749605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d129af6346e16ddad4a0ce00654fe1647cff1d74 OP_EQUALVERIFY OP_CHECKSIG
address
1L4xARdcy7veC4dHERSSPW1JqzcJ2ArXx5
transaction
cd3c24ed3b66516813c67e83d620e6eedfced6c641a5f442882378c59da8bbe7
confirmations
624280
spent
true